链路追踪中间件在数据存储方面有哪些考虑?
随着信息技术的飞速发展,链路追踪中间件在提高系统性能、优化用户体验方面发挥着越来越重要的作用。在数据存储方面,链路追踪中间件需要考虑诸多因素,以确保数据的安全、可靠和高效。本文将围绕链路追踪中间件在数据存储方面的考虑展开论述。
一、数据存储的安全性
数据加密:链路追踪中间件在存储数据时,需要对敏感信息进行加密处理,如用户隐私数据、业务数据等。这可以有效防止数据泄露,保障用户隐私安全。
访问控制:为了防止未授权访问,链路追踪中间件应采用严格的访问控制策略,如基于角色的访问控制(RBAC)等。只有具备相应权限的用户才能访问特定数据。
数据备份:为了防止数据丢失,链路追踪中间件需要定期进行数据备份。在备份过程中,可采用增量备份或全量备份,以确保数据完整性。
二、数据存储的可靠性
分布式存储:链路追踪中间件应采用分布式存储技术,如分布式文件系统(DFS)等。这样可以提高数据存储的可靠性,降低单点故障风险。
数据冗余:在数据存储过程中,应确保数据冗余。当某个存储节点出现故障时,其他节点可以接管其工作,保证数据不丢失。
故障转移:链路追踪中间件应具备故障转移能力,当主节点出现故障时,可以从备份节点快速切换,确保系统正常运行。
三、数据存储的高效性
索引优化:链路追踪中间件在存储数据时,需要对数据进行索引,以便快速检索。通过优化索引策略,可以提高数据检索效率。
缓存机制:为了提高数据访问速度,链路追踪中间件可以采用缓存机制。将常用数据缓存到内存中,减少对磁盘的访问次数。
读写分离:在分布式存储环境中,链路追踪中间件可以采用读写分离策略。将读操作和写操作分配到不同的节点,提高系统并发处理能力。
四、案例分析
以下以某大型电商平台为例,说明链路追踪中间件在数据存储方面的应用。
数据安全性:该电商平台采用数据加密技术,对用户隐私数据进行加密存储。同时,采用RBAC策略,确保只有具备相应权限的人员才能访问敏感数据。
数据可靠性:电商平台采用分布式文件系统,将数据分散存储在多个节点上。同时,实施数据冗余策略,确保数据不丢失。
数据高效性:电商平台采用索引优化技术,提高数据检索效率。此外,通过缓存机制和读写分离策略,提高系统并发处理能力。
综上所述,链路追踪中间件在数据存储方面需要考虑数据安全性、可靠性、高效性等因素。通过采用合适的存储技术和策略,可以确保数据的安全、可靠和高效,为用户提供优质的服务。
猜你喜欢:全景性能监控